Ed Balow purchased a Jack Daniels Half Marathon Training Plan last December. His goal race is in two weeks at the Run Raleigh Half. Recently, Ed checked in with us after jumping in a local half marathon simply to do his marathon pace workout.
My intention was to run it as a 2 mile easy, 8 miles at marathon pace workout, but to go hard the last 5K of the race. Amazingly, it went according to plan. It was fun to have those first 2 easy miles because I pretty much blew by everyone for the next 5 or 6 miles until I settled into the group of folks at my 7:30 pace. I had lots of energy left after 10 miles and was able to finish strong coming in at 1:39:30 which blows my old half PR out of the water by about 15 minutes!
Regardless of what happens in two weeks I already consider this plan a great success. You got me into starting corral C for the Chicago Marathon and sub 1:40, and I didn’t even have to race very hard to get it!
